Product reviews:
Joshua
2025-04-06 iphone 11
Sloth Plush, Extra Large - Walmart.com giant sloth stuffed animal walmart black friday
giant sloth stuffed animal walmart black friday
Maximilian
2025-04-04 iphone SE
Holiday Time Big Foot Sloth Plush giant sloth stuffed animal walmart black friday
giant sloth stuffed animal walmart black friday
Tiffany
2025-03-30 iphone 6s Plus
Sloth Stuffed Animals - Walmart.com giant sloth stuffed animal walmart black friday
giant sloth stuffed animal walmart black friday